I've only given it about 1.5 really solid listens, but from some of the more tentative reception it's received around here, I was basically expecting an album of average Mynabirds songs slathered carelessly in dense synths, and it completely shattered those expectations -- I think these songs (as raw compositions) are mostly up to their usual sterling standards, and found the arrangements to be artful and evocative. The way more than a few of these tunes employ their synthesized instrumentation reminds me of albums like "Amnesiac" and "The Terror," as they move seamlessly from passages that feel jittery and anxious to ones that feel sweeping and rhapsodic. I will be listening a lot more but on first listen my favorites are "Believer," "Wildfire," and "Omaha." And "Semantics" sounds way better on the album.
